Three caught in Hyderabad for selling e-cigarettes illegally

The Hyderabad Commissioner’s Task Force (south east) caught three men for allegedly selling e-cigarettes in the city. Police seized 190 e-cigarettes, motorcycles, phones, and cash. The accused were handed over to Abids Police Station for further action

Hyderabad: The Hyderabad Commissioner’s Task Force (south east) zone on Saturday caught three persons who were allegedly selling e-cigarettes and seized 190 e-cigarettes, two motorcycles, three phones, and Rs 13,500 cash from them.

Those apprehended are Mohd Sultan Khan (38), Mohd Kabir Hussain (22) and Mohd Moid Pasha (23).


According to the police, the trio were purchasing the e-cigarettes from one person, Sami, and selling them to customers in the city at a higher price.

On a tip-off, the police caught them and seized the property.

The arrested persons along with the property were handed over to Abids Police Station for further action.
